Sinopse

The complete New York Times–bestselling series that began with the acclaimed romance, Shiver, “a lyrical tale of alienated werewolves and first love” (Publishers Weekly). In Shiver, meet Sam. He’s not just a normal boy—he has a secret. During the summer he walks and talks as a human, but when the cold comes, he runs with his pack as a wolf. Grace has spent years watching the wolves in the woods behind her house—but never dreamed that she would fall in love with one of them. Linger tells the story of Sam and Grace’s struggle to stay together, and the dangerous secret Grace must keep from everyone, including her parents. In Forever, wolves are being hunted, which means the stakes are even higher for Grace and Sam and the wolf pack. With Sinner comes the long awaited story of Cole, a wolf wrestling with his own demons, and his attempt to win back Isabel Culper For Grace, Sam, and Cole and Isabel, life is harrowing and euphoric, enticing and alarming. As their world falls apart, love is what lingers. But can it be enough? “Beautiful and moving.” —School Library Journal on Shiver This sequel’s poetic prose skillfully captures the four teens’ longings for love, forgetting, remembering, righting wrongs and life itself.” —Kirkus Reviews on Linger
